A downstairs toilet can be a valuable addition to your home, providing convenience and privacy. However, these spaces are often compact, which can make designing a functional and stylish bathroom challenging. Don't worry! With clever designs and some creative hacks, you can transform even the smallest downstairs toilet into a welcoming and efficient space.

  • Consider incorporating a wall-mounted sink to maximize floor space.
  • Go up, not out by adding shelves or cabinets for storage.
  • Opt for a compact toilet to free up valuable room.
  • Choose a bright color palette to make the space feel larger and more airy.
